For keeping safe and secure critical data online, we (a non profit organisation and a small group of managers) use the
encryptedpasswords plugin inside private namespaces.
It is possible using many times the same password in a page to keep an easy way to navigate the encrypted data with wiki syntax. You cannot protect medias with, only text.
It is not 100 % secure (nothing is 100 % secure) but as we use https and ModSecurity (Web Application Firewall) module and have a strong passwords politic for login, it seems enough for us to encrypt data in private namespaces to get the extra needed. Easy to set up and to use as a secure vault online for all the passwords needed (Bank and Insurance Accounts, tel numbers,...). As it is on a case-by-case basis, I am confident in this configuration, at this moment.
